I replied directly (PM) to a request about the VEEP to Mars scenario presenting a solution to him of a single 4100 m/s burn to go to Mars which was obtained using a surrogate. But later I played around just by gut feel and found a nicer (but related) one with a single 3800 m/s burn.
In the DGIV Mission Scenary folder is the Martian bound VEEP challenge.

Solution:
On start of scenario leave both ship and pod docked but change the date using scenario editor forward about 18 days to 60266.5000
Then undock the ship only and set up the following TransX maneuver.

Prograde= 3.78 Km/sec
Outward= 0.0
Plane Change = -295 m/sec

For the date of the maneuver, after the above values are input, advance the date. But you should first set up the next 2 stages so you can see what the date input is providing. So, escape Titan, then forward, escape Saturn, then forward, target Mars and leave one MFD in stage 3 (Solar orbit with Mars as target).

Back to date of the maneuver... advance it using ultra and soon you will see (in stage 3) the trajectory showing a path inward toward the inner planets. You should continue advancing the date past the point where the Pe goes inside Mars orbit and as you advance the date more the Pe will start to rise again and as it gets up to Mars, advance on hyper steps. I found that somewhere around 60266.5657 give or take it will show a very close encounter with Mars. A trick is to now have the Stage 3 "scale to view" set to "Target", for a nice close in view of the encounter.

Now grapple the fuel pod. You will have about 80 minutes or more to complete this before the burn is scheduled to be done. Hope that's enough time for you. :thumbup:
